How Thermal Imaging Works for Leak Detection

Thermal cameras detect infrared energy emitted by objects. Water absorbs and holds heat differently than drywall, wood, or concrete. When a leak occurs, the affected materials stay cooler or warmer than surrounding areas. Our FLIR cameras capture these temperature anomalies and display them as color gradients on a screen. Blue areas often indicate moisture. Red areas show heat sources. This creates a moisture map without touching a single surface.. The science gets more specific. Evaporative cooling occurs when water evaporates from surfaces. This process pulls heat away, creating a cold spot that shows up clearly on thermal scans. In Miller-Main Street homes, we often find slab leaks that cause floor temperatures to drop by 3-5°F. The camera sees this difference instantly. We also detect condensation on cold water pipes during summer months. The technology works through paint, wallpaper, and even ceramic tile.. Common OKC Leak Scenarios in Miller-Main Street Homes

Miller-Main Street homes built before 1980 often have galvanized steel pipes. These corrode from the inside out. By the time you notice low water pressure, the pipes may have already leaked for months inside your walls. Thermal imaging finds these slow leaks by detecting the constant moisture presence. Oklahoma’s expansive clay soil shifts with moisture changes. This movement stresses plumbing connections under your slab. We find these slab leaks using thermal imaging combined with acoustic listening devices. The camera shows the moisture pattern. The microphone confirms the leak location. Winter ice storms hit Miller-Main Street hard. When temperatures drop below 20°F, exposed pipes freeze and burst. The water spreads through walls before you notice. Thermal imaging detects the initial burst point and tracks the water migration path. We can see exactly how far the water traveled through insulation and wall cavities.

Heavy spring rains overwhelm Oklahoma City’s storm sewer systems. Water backs up through floor drains and sump pump failures. Thermal cameras detect the moisture in basements and crawl spaces within minutes. We map the affected area and determine which materials need removal versus drying and restoration.. The Benefits of Non-Invasive Technology

Traditional leak detection destroys your home to find problems. Plumbers cut holes in walls. They tear up floors. They remove ceiling sections. Each cut costs you money for repairs. Thermal imaging eliminates this destruction. We scan the entire area first. Then we only cut where absolutely necessary.

Cost savings add up fast. A typical wall repair costs $300-500. A ceiling repair runs $400-600. Floor replacement starts at $1,000. Thermal imaging often prevents all these repairs by showing us the exact leak location. We make one small access hole instead of multiple exploratory cuts.. Our Process: From Thermal Scan to Complete Restoration

We start with a comprehensive thermal scan of your entire property. The technician walks through every room with the FLIR camera. They scan walls, floors, ceilings, and foundations. The camera captures thousands of data points. We create a digital moisture map showing every temperature anomaly.

Next comes moisture verification. We use pinless moisture meters to confirm the thermal camera findings. The meters measure actual moisture content in materials. Once we locate all leaks, we develop a restoration plan. The plan shows you exactly what needs repair. We mark the affected areas on your floor plan. We provide photos from the thermal camera showing the damage. You see the same data we use to make decisions.

Emergency mitigation begins immediately. We extract standing water. We set up industrial dehumidifiers. We install air movers to create airflow. The thermal camera guides our equipment placement. Final verification uses thermal imaging again. We scan the area after drying to confirm all moisture is gone. The camera shows clear temperature patterns across dried surfaces. This documentation proves the job is complete and prevents future problems from hidden dampness.

Frequently Asked Questions

How accurate is thermal imaging for finding leaks?

Thermal imaging detects temperature differences as small as 0.1°F. When combined with moisture meters, accuracy exceeds 95%. The technology works through most building materials including drywall, plaster, wood, and ceramic tile.

Can thermal cameras see through walls?

Thermal cameras do not see through walls. They detect temperature differences on the surface caused by what is behind the wall. Moisture creates cold spots that show up clearly on the camera display.

How long does a thermal inspection take?

A typical residential inspection takes 30-60 minutes. We scan every room, verify findings with moisture meters, and create a comprehensive report. Larger homes or commercial properties may require 2-3 hours.

Is thermal imaging safe for my home?

Yes. Thermal cameras emit no radiation. They simply detect infrared energy already present. The technology is completely non-invasive and safe for all building materials and occupants.
